Box ScoreUpdated Season StatsThe Louisiana College Lady Wildcats opened American Southwest Conference play on Thursday afternoon at home, dropping a hard fought 2-1 decision to the Concordia Tornados at Wildcat Field in Pineville.
Â
The Tornadoes were able to gain an early advantage when Concordia's Nicole Henderson broke free in the 8
th minute of the first half and found the back of the net to give the vistors a 1-0 lead.
Â
But just as she has done all season long to this point, LC's
Jayme Harmon had an answer, as her team-leading sixth goal of the season in the 40
th minute of the first half tied the match at 1-1 just before halftime.
Â
The Tornados would not go away, however, and Maddison Hoskins' goal 15 minutes into the second half would give Concordia a 2-1 lead and ultimately proved to be the game-winning goal.
Â
The loss drops the Lady Cats to 3-3 on the season, as they will close out their current three-game homestand on Saturday at 2:00 p.m. against Mary Hardin-Baylor in an ASC matchup at Wildcat Field.
